Overview

A toolkit for firmware development.

Simplicity and code size are considered first while trying to avoid dynamic allocation as much as possible. No linker script tweak required.

The documentation of each modules are under the subdirectories. Some usage examples can also be found under examples and test cases.

Integration Guide

The library can be intergrated in your project as a git submodule, using CMake FetchContent, or downloading manually.

git submodule

Include libmcu into your project

$ cd ${YOUR_PROJECT_DIR}
$ git submodule add https://github.com/libmcu/libmcu.git ${THIRD_PARTY_DIR}/libmcu

Add libmcu into your build system

Make
LIBMCU_ROOT ?= <THIRD_PARTY_DIR>/libmcu
# The commented lines below are optional. All modules and interfaces included
# by default if not specified.
#LIBMCU_MODULES := actor metrics
include $(LIBMCU_ROOT)/projects/modules.mk

<SRC_FILES> += $(LIBMCU_MODULES_SRCS)
<INC_PATHS> += $(LIBMCU_MODULES_INCS)

#LIBMCU_INTERFACES := gpio pwm
include $(LIBMCU_ROOT)/projects/interfaces.mk

<SRC_FILES> += $(LIBMCU_INTERFACES_SRCS)
<INC_PATHS> += $(LIBMCU_INTERFACES_INCS)
CMake
add_subdirectory(<THIRD_PARTY_DIR>/libmcu)

or

set(LIBMCU_ROOT <THIRD_PARTY_DIR>/libmcu)
#list(APPEND LIBMCU_MODULES metrics pubsub)
include(${LIBMCU_ROOT}/projects/modules.cmake)

#list(APPEND LIBMCU_INTERFACES i2c uart)
include(${LIBMCU_ROOT}/projects/interfaces.cmake)

# Add ${LIBMCU_MODULES_SRCS} to your target sources
# Add ${LIBMCU_MODULES_INCS} to your target includes

CMake FetchContent

include(FetchContent)
FetchContent_Declare(libmcu
		     GIT_REPOSITORY https://github.com/libmcu/libmcu.git
		     GIT_TAG main
)
FetchContent_MakeAvailable(libmcu)
